What is A/B Testing?

A/B testing compares two versions of a product or feature to see which one performs better. Imagine you’re testing a new button color on your app. Version A has the original color, while Version B has the new color. You show Version A to one group of users and Version B to another. You can see whether the new color improves user engagement by comparing how each group reacts.

This might sound simple, but A/B testing is a powerful tool that helps you make decisions based on user behavior rather than guessing what might work.

Why is A/B Testing Important?

A/B testing allows you to validate your hypotheses with actual data. Instead of relying on gut feelings or assumptions, you can see how real users respond to changes. This is crucial because even small changes can impact how users interact with your product.

For example, adding more features to a page will make it more appealing. But what if users find it overwhelming? Without testing, you won’t know for sure. A/B testing gives you that certainty.
